Output efbf65bfe2fbf21c1a8014f19fe7585a7c32d261e5e70b79795223ca8c2da340:4

value
6095767
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 910a145b095329e0332017782889b35e7abbbfaa OP_EQUALVERIFY OP_CHECKSIG
address
1EDu49qS9Q6Sjvu9FHsQf1UnDgBAzoDCdx
transaction
efbf65bfe2fbf21c1a8014f19fe7585a7c32d261e5e70b79795223ca8c2da340
spent
true